I bit the bullet and joined the crossfit gym down the street from work. I did 3 weeks of "on ramp" which teaches you the basics of the exercises. It was a lot of fun, I totally love it. Mike thinks I'm even more insane now, but well, you'll have that. Today was my last class. We did the Ben workout again, which is the same workout we did the first class. My time then was 6:11. Today was 4:55. It's run 200 meters, 15-12-9 of ring pull ups, pushups and airsquats, then 200 meter run. More impressive to me than the time was that I didn't need to alter the ring pull ups any, I did them all without any modifications. The pushups, I did go to my knees after the first set. I probably could have done them all...I was worried about my time though.
